Table of Contents - cgi: Ruby Standard Library Documentation
Classes and Modules
-
CGI
- Overview
- Introduction
- Queries
- Environmental Variables
- Parameters
- Cookies
- Multipart requests
- Responses
- Writing output
- Generating HTML
- Utility HTML escape and other methods like a function.
- Examples of use
- Get form values
- Get form values as hash
- Save form values to file
- Restore form values from file
- Get multipart form values
- Get cookie values
- Get cookie objects
- Print http header and html string to $DEFAULT_OUTPUT ($>)
- Some utility methods
- Some utility methods like a function
- CGI::Cookie
- CGI::HTML3
- CGI::HTML4
- CGI::HTML4Fr
- CGI::HTML4Tr
- CGI::HTML5
- CGI::HtmlExtension
- CGI::InvalidEncoding
- CGI::QueryExtension
- CGI::Session
- CGI::Session::FileStore
- CGI::Session::MemoryStore
- CGI::Session::NullStore
- CGI::Session::PStore
- CGI::Util
Methods
- ::accept_charset — CGI
- ::accept_charset= — CGI
- ::new — CGI
- ::new — CGI::Cookie
- ::new — CGI::Session
- ::new — CGI::Session::FileStore
- ::new — CGI::Session::MemoryStore
- ::new — CGI::Session::NullStore
- ::new — CGI::Session::PStore
- ::parse — CGI
- ::parse — CGI::Cookie
- #[] — CGI::Session
- #[] — CGI::QueryExtension
- #[]= — CGI::Session
- #_no_crlf_check — CGI
- #a — CGI::HtmlExtension
- #base — CGI::HtmlExtension
- #blockquote — CGI::HtmlExtension
- #caption — CGI::HtmlExtension
- #checkbox — CGI::HtmlExtension
- #checkbox_group — CGI::HtmlExtension
- #close — CGI::Session
- #close — CGI::Session::FileStore
- #close — CGI::Session::MemoryStore
- #close — CGI::Session::NullStore
- #close — CGI::Session::PStore
- #create_new_id — CGI::Session
- #delete — CGI::Session
- #delete — CGI::Session::FileStore
- #delete — CGI::Session::MemoryStore
- #delete — CGI::Session::NullStore
- #delete — CGI::Session::PStore
- #domain= — CGI::Cookie
- #env_table — CGI
- #escape — CGI::Util
- #escapeElement — CGI::Util
- #escapeHTML — CGI::Util
- #escapeURIComponent — CGI::Util
- #escape_element — CGI::Util
- #escape_html — CGI::Util
- #escape_uri_component — CGI::Util
- #file_field — CGI::HtmlExtension
- #form — CGI::HtmlExtension
- #h — CGI::Util
- #has_key? — CGI::QueryExtension
- #header — CGI
- #hidden — CGI::HtmlExtension
- #html — CGI::HtmlExtension
- #http_header — CGI
- #httponly= — CGI::Cookie
- #image_button — CGI::HtmlExtension
- #img — CGI::HtmlExtension
- #include? — CGI::QueryExtension
- #initialize_query — CGI::QueryExtension
- #inspect — CGI::Cookie
- #key? — CGI::QueryExtension
- #keys — CGI::QueryExtension
- #multipart? — CGI::QueryExtension
- #multipart_form — CGI::HtmlExtension
- #name= — CGI::Cookie
- #out — CGI
- #params= — CGI::QueryExtension
- #password_field — CGI::HtmlExtension
- #path= — CGI::Cookie
- #popup_menu — CGI::HtmlExtension
- #pretty — CGI::Util
- #print — CGI
- #radio_button — CGI::HtmlExtension
- #radio_group — CGI::HtmlExtension
- #raw_cookie — CGI::QueryExtension
- #raw_cookie2 — CGI::QueryExtension
- #read_from_cmdline — CGI::QueryExtension
- #read_multipart — CGI::QueryExtension
- #reset — CGI::HtmlExtension
- #restore — CGI::Session::FileStore
- #restore — CGI::Session::MemoryStore
- #restore — CGI::Session::NullStore
- #restore — CGI::Session::PStore
- #rfc1123_date — CGI::Util
- #scrolling_list — CGI::HtmlExtension
- #secure= — CGI::Cookie
- #stdinput — CGI
- #stdoutput — CGI
- #submit — CGI::HtmlExtension
- #text_field — CGI::HtmlExtension
- #textarea — CGI::HtmlExtension
- #to_s — CGI::Cookie
- #unescape — CGI::Util
- #unescapeElement — CGI::Util
- #unescapeHTML — CGI::Util
- #unescapeURIComponent — CGI::Util
- #unescape_element — CGI::Util
- #unescape_html — CGI::Util
- #unescape_uri_component — CGI::Util
- #update — CGI::Session
- #update — CGI::Session::FileStore
- #update — CGI::Session::MemoryStore
- #update — CGI::Session::NullStore
- #update — CGI::Session::PStore
- #value — CGI::Cookie
- #value= — CGI::Cookie